About the Role
Pathfinder International seeks an Executive Assistant to VP, Strategic Engagement & Innovation to provide senior-level administrative support to the Vice President and the Strategic Engagement & Innovation (SEI) leadership teams. This full-time position is based in Kenya and serves a core function within the organization’s international development and donor-engagement operations. You will work directly with the VP and coordinate across multiple departments including Individual Giving, Lighthouse, Communications, and External Engagement, acting as a trusted operational partner who ensures the department runs with precision and accountability.
This is an Administration in Kenya role that demands strong judgment, discretion, and the ability to manage competing priorities in a complex, multicultural environment. You will report directly to the Vice President and play a central role in enabling strategic initiatives through meticulous planning, stakeholder coordination, and follow-through on organizational commitments.
Key Responsibilities
- Manage the VP’s calendar and those of SEI leadership, scheduling appointments with internal and external stakeholders while balancing organizational priorities and strategic alignment.
- Prepare agendas, pre-briefing materials, and action item follow-ups for high-level internal and external meetings.
- Serve as the primary point of contact between the VP, SEI teams, and stakeholders, ensuring responsive and timely communication.
- Plan, coordinate, and execute complex international and domestic travel itineraries, including flight arrangements, accommodation, ground logistics, and expense management.
- Lead event logistics for donor meetings, stakeholder visits, and in-house functions, including venue selection, agenda development, hospitality arrangements, and coordination with communications and fundraising teams.
- Process and reconcile expense reports, invoices, and contracts in compliance with organizational policy; maintain organized records and knowledge-management systems to support departmental accessibility and efficiency.
- Prepare materials for Board of Directors meetings, donor engagements, and governance-related events; track deliverables and deadlines to ensure accountability and follow-through.
- Respond quickly to last-minute changes and troubleshoot logistical challenges with minimal disruption to operations.
Requirements & Qualifications
- Bachelor’s degree in Office Administration, Communications, International Relations, Secretarial Studies, or a related field.
- Minimum 3–5 years of progressively responsible administrative and executive support experience with C-level executives, senior leadership, or Board governance in an international or multicultural organization.
- Demonstrated experience managing complex calendars, travel logistics, high-level meetings, and handling confidential information.
- Proven track record liaising with senior stakeholders, including donors, board members, government officials, and partner organizations.
- Advanced pro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Outlook) and collaboration tools (Teams, Zoom, SharePoint); familiarity with expense reporting systems such as Concur is advantageous.
- Strong written and verbal communication skills; ability to draft correspondence, reports, and presentations with accuracy and professionalism.
- High level of discretion, integrity, and confidentiality when managing sensitive matters.
- Independent, resourceful problem-solver with the ability to anticipate needs and take initiative; strong interpersonal skills and capacity to interact effectively across organizational levels and cultures.
Preferred Qualifications
- Three or more years of experience supporting executive-level management.
- Professional training or certification in Executive Assistance, Project Management, or Office Administration.
- Background working in a non-profit organization or international development sector.
- Fluency in French, Portuguese, or Amharic.
